Life
Discover how Seamus Heaney’s formative years in the Bellaghy area shaped his life and were a source of inspiration throughout his career. Our exhibition is packed with poetry, photographs and stories that take you to the heart of Heaney’s life and work.
Literature
Browse our library, where you will see on display hundreds of books donated by the Heaney family from Seamus Heaney’s own collection, or immerse yourself in our exploration of the poet’s words, rhythm and rhyme.
Inspiration
Savour a piece of theatre, music or poetry in our performance space, The Helicon, or get hands on with a range of engaging arts and crafts activities that will soon get the creativity flowing for kids and adults alike. Be inspired by your visit.
